Zığra
Zığra is a neighbourhood of the city Kütahya, Kütahya District, Kütahya Province, Turkey. Its population is 3,416 (2022). It is located just northeast of the city of Kütahya Kütahya () (historically, Cotyaeum or Kotyaion, Ancient Greek, Greek: Κοτύαιον) is a city in western Turkey which lies on the Porsuk River, Porsuk river, at 969 metres above sea level. It is inhabited by some 578,640 people (2022 estimate) .... The main road in and out of the village is Alayunt Street, which starts in Kütahya and runs east, through Zığra, to Alayunt. Although a double-track railway runs through the village, Zığra does not have a railway station. The muhtar of Zığra is Kadir Yeşildağ.List of mayors in Kütahya
